drm/i915/display: Use display parent interface for i915 runtime pm
authorJouni Högander <jouni.hogander@intel.com>
Thu, 30 Oct 2025 20:28:35 +0000 (22:28 +0200)
committerJouni Högander <jouni.hogander@intel.com>
Mon, 3 Nov 2025 09:55:22 +0000 (11:55 +0200)
Start using display parent interface for i915 runtime pm. Doing the same
for xe is done in coming changes.

v3:
  - remove useless include
v2:
  - use <> when including drm/intel/display_parent_interface.h
  - drop checks for validity of rpm function pointers
